"For shy children, or anyone apprehensive when navigating new situations, this picture book about missed opportunities to greet one another is a must. Through her masterly use of evasive language and negative space, Kim whimsically exhorts us to connect." New York TImes
Hello! It seems so easy to say, but what happens if you miss the chance to greet someone and then keep seeing that same person again and again.
In this light-hearted, funny tale, Korean author Sung Mi Kim tells a story of increasingly awkward encounters between Mr. Wolf and Little Fox and shows readers how saying hello right from the beginning could have made all the difference.
"This simple Korean import is told primarily through the characters’ dialogue and thoughts, making it a perfect choice for dramatic read-alouds and role-playing to help children empathize with others and polish their social graces." Kirkus Reviews
